Theorie der Schusswunden und ihre Behandlung. by Pierre Dufouart, offers a detailed examination of gunshot wounds and their treatment. Written in German, this historical text provides insights into surgical practices and medical understanding during the late 18th century. Dufouart's work is an invaluable resource for those interested in the history of medicine, particularly the evolution of surgical techniques and wound care in the context of military and civilian life. The book delves into the theoretical underpinnings of wound pathology and presents practical approaches to treatment, reflecting the state-of-the-art medical knowledge of the time.
